Great to see new ramps being made.
Any chance we might see some of the older ones restocked, specifically Space Shuttle ?
Honestly, Space Shuttle will probably be one of the last I do. The thicker plastic on that one has created a huge problem. It will be difficult to hand form a ramp off the tool and then redo the tool to make the thicker ramp work. My plan is to do all the HIPS products first.

I have over 200 original Williams tools. I am using those first because it saves both time and money and lowers the cost of the ramps. I may never get to any non Williams games. I have 2 tools for Radical that I have not looked at yet. One of the tools has 2 parts on it.

Quoted from Muskie82:TMNT? Who has the original tools for the data east games?
I dont think any of the data east molds were saved.
To my knowledge, none of the DE, Stern, Sega molds were kept or stored. Someday perhaps they may still be found. Until then pretty much the only hope you have is Marc and me. In the future, I hope to devote more of my time to new products but have done a pretty bad job so far.

I'm answering several questions asked on Freeplay40's post. The ramps that have been made since I took over the business are Cyclone Ferris Wheel, Earthshaker subway, Twilight Zone subway, World Cup soccer, whirlwind lift, and bad cats. In addition, hardware has been added to over 30 ramps to ensure all riveted parts are supplied with the ramp. Most of the chromed parts we have been out of for years will be rolling out over the next month. Whitewater mountains are actually done but they have to be hand painted. The demand for the WCS ramps has been huge and they are time-consuming to prep. We're not going to be able to paint the mountains for a week or 2. Will let everyone know as the parts become available.
